检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
(密码和访问密钥)。 在我的凭证下,您可以查看账号ID和用户ID。通常在调用API的鉴权过程中,您需要用到账号、用户和密码等信息。 区域 指云资源所在的物理位置,同一区域内可用区间内网互通,不同区域间内网不互通。通过在不同地区创建云资源,可以将应用程序设计的更接近特定客户的要求,或满足不同地区的法律或其他要求。
用户在使用云服务时,帐户的可用额度小于待结算的账单,即被判定为帐户欠费。欠费后,可能会影响DDM实例的正常运行,请及时充值。 欠费原因 未购买包年/包月实例,在按需计费模式下帐户的余额不足。 欠费影响 包年/包月 对于包年/包月的DDM实例,用户已经预先支付了资源费用,因此在帐户出现欠费的情况下,
费模式的DDM计费项如表1所示。 表1 支持变更计费模式的DDM计费项 计费项 变更说明 相关文档 实例规格(vCPU和内存) 变更DDM实例的计费模式会同时变更计算资源(vCPU和内存)的计费模式。 将DDM实例的计费模式从按需计费转为包年/包月,可以让您享受一定程度的价格优惠。
如果DDM内核版本小于3.1.0版本,系统默认开启读写分离,只需要调整只读实例和主实例的读写权重即可以实现读写分离操作。此场景下不能关闭读写分离功能。 设置读权重 主要用于调整主实例和只读实例的读写权重,实现读写分离操作。 支持批量设置多个实例的读写权重。 如果数据节点未挂载只读实例,该主实例无法设置权重。
MySQL数据库中的表在DDM实例中重新创建,根据表的性质可选择创建为广播表、单表、拆分表。广播表和单表的使用场景请参考广播表和单表的使用场景。 图1 原数据库表 图2 address_test表数据 图3 user_test表数据 执行以下命令,将源数据库中的“user_tes
应参数),本接口文档将及时刷新内容。 为了减少接口变更带来的影响,除了DDM服务自身尽量做到接口向下兼容的同时,您在使用过程中,应当接受出现返回内容(JSON格式)含有未使用的参数和值的现象,即能够正常忽略未使用的参数和值。 父主题: 使用前必读
购买更符合业务的分布式数据库中间件实例。 表1 DDM最佳实践一览表 章节名称 简介 合理制定分片策略 介绍创建拆分表时如何选择拆分键和拆分算法。 如何选择DDM逻辑库分片数 介绍创建拆分库时如何合理选择逻辑库分片。 广播表和单表的使用场景 介绍广播表和单表的常用场景。 DDM事务模型
量计费EIP。 详细内容请参见按需计费(按流量计费)和按需计费(按带宽计费)互相转换。 该变更操作成功后,新的计费方式将立即生效。 按需实例转包周期 登录管理控制台。 单击管理控制台左上角的,选择区域和项目。 单击页面左上角的,选择“数据库 > 分布式数据库中间件 DDM”,进入分布式数据库中间件服务页面。
FROM <database> 说明: 仅支持=、in、like三种操作符,和and条件关联。 不支持子查询、关联查询、排序、聚合查询、LIMIT等等复杂查询。 information_schema.tables和information_schema.columns支持<>操作符。 父主题:
FULL_PERCENTAGE:当前扩容子任务的全量迁移完成百分比。 将各个扩容子任务的全部全量对象总量和已完成全量对象总量进行汇聚,得到当前扩容任务的全量迁移总量和已完成量,即展示在“任务中心”的进度条数据 在“任务中心”单击操作栏的“更多 > 修改切换策略”可以对分片变更的切换策略进行修改。 图6
正在进行实例SSL切换。 端口修改中 正在修改DDM实例的服务端口。 删除中 正在删除DDM实例。 重启中 正在重启DDM实例。 节点扩容中 正在扩容该实例下的节点个数。 节点缩容中 正在缩容该实例下的节点个数。 规格变更中 正在变更实例的CPU和内存规格。 转包周期中 按需付费实例正在转为包周期实例。
当前请求需要用户验证,如需要用户名和密码。 403 Forbidden 禁止访问请求页面。 404 Not Found 请求失败,在服务器上未找到请求所希望得到的资源。 405 Method Not Allowed 请求行中指定的请求方法不能被用于请求相应的资源。 409 Conflict 由于和被请求的
使用限制 网络访问使用限制 DN实例使用限制 不支持的特性和使用限制 高危操作提示
拆分表的数据量一般都达到千万级,因此选择合适的拆分算法和拆分键非常重要。如果能找到业务主体,并且确定绝大部分的数据库操作都是围绕这个主体的数据进行的,那么可以选择这个主体所对应的表字段作为拆分键,进行水平拆分。 业务逻辑主体与实际应用场景相关,下列场景都有明确的业务逻辑主体。 银行类客户业务应用,业务逻
delete_rds_data=true {endpoint}信息请从地区和终端节点获取。 响应示例 { "id":"d0b008c1ee95479d8799710d9f3a4097in09" } 删除DDM实例,不删除关联RDS上存储的数据。 接口相关信息 URI格式:DELETE /v1
QL忽略索引。 key_len 使用的索引的长度。在不损失精确性的情况下,长度越短越好。 ref 显示索引被使用的列,通常为一个常数。 rows MySQL用来返回请求数据的行数。 Extra 关于MySQL如何解析查询的额外信息。 SQL大类限制 不支持临时表。 不支持外键、视图、游标、触发器及存储过程。
致,如果JOIN查询,将所有参与JOIN的字段都添加到select后的查询字段列表中,这样能提升SELECT查询效率。 对于UNION中的每个SELECT, DDM 暂不支持使用多个同名的列。 例如: 如下SQL的SELECT中存在重复的列名。 SELECT id, id, name
会影响DDM对join算法的选择,无法使用最高效的算法。 这里的大表和小表的意思不是指原始表的规模,指的是经过where条件过滤之后的数据规模。 子查询 不建议子查询包含在OR表达式中,或者是子查询的关联条件包含在OR表达式中 不建议使用含有limit的标量子查询,如 select
创建用户 注意事项 DDM账户的基础权限base_authority只能通过控制台界面来修改。 DDM账户拥有逻辑库的任意表级权限或者库级权限,控制台界面就会展示已关联该逻辑库。 Create user只支持用户级权限。 删除逻辑库,删除表不会影响DDM账户的grant info权限信息。
在左侧导航栏选择“账号管理”,进入账号管理页面。 在账号管理页面单击“创建DDM账号”,在弹窗中填选账号信息、关联的逻辑库和权限。 DDM目标库账号所需要的权限可参考DRS使用须知中的数据库权限说明。 信息填写完成,单击“确定”即可创建成功。 父主题: 目标端DDM准备